Video advertising. Live video streaming can be a feature that has become more popular then ever among internet sites. Using live video streaming for international marketing techniques efforts is especially effective for its capacity to give consumers and potential customers the opportunity to experience a "real-time" event irrespective of where they may be on this planet. Several companies have realized live streaming becoming a particularly useful strategy to conduct question and answer sessions with viewers. This kind of active participation generates a unique connectedness relating to the business and its customers, greatly enhancing loyalty on the brand by the participants and allowing the viewers to offer live testimonials regarding the products or services.

Cross-sector marketing. Put very simply, cross-sector marketing refers to the practice employing very good of other brands to improve the reputation and success of your personal. The fast-food industry gives a good demonstration of cross-sector marketing at its simplest level. Studies have shown that fast-food restaurants that are clustered together within a short distance of one another report markedly higher sales than others in more isolated locations. This may sound counterintuitive, but the facts are that several different fast-food restaurants located within the same few blocks provide the consumer which has a tremendous variety of choices and boost the likelihood that shoppers will minimize you can eat. Professional marketers project that cross-sector international marketing can be more commonplace with this coming year, including an increase in strategic partnerships to get a larger amount of success for anyone involved.
